  • Can Cat Eat Rice Everyday

    Cats should not eat rice every day. While small amounts can give them quick energy, rice does not provide the protein they need. Too much rice can cause weight gain, diabetes, and stomach problems like diarrhea.

    Limit rice to one teaspoon of cooked rice. This is about 5 calories. Treats should make up less than 10% of a cat’s daily calories. Always serve plain, cooked rice.

  • Can Cat Eat Rice Cakes

    Rice cakes are not safe for cats. Their hard texture can upset your cat’s stomach. This can lead to vomiting or diarrhea. Rice cakes also have very little nutrition. Each cake only has about 0.73 grams of protein. That’s much less than what your cat needs.

    Flavored rice cakes may have harmful ingredients. Salt and garlic can be dangerous for cats. Instead of rice cakes, give your cat meat-based treats. These treats provide the nutrients cats require. Look for options that are safe and healthy for your furry friend.

  • Can Cat Eat Refried Beans

    Feeding your cat refried beans is not safe. These beans often have harmful ingredients like garlic and onion. These can hurt your cat’s red blood cells and lead to anemia. High salt levels in refried beans can also stress their kidneys.

    Cats need taurine for good health, and beans do not provide this important nutrient. Instead, consider safe options like well-cooked black beans, chickpeas, or lentils.   • Can Cat Eat Raw Spinach

    Feeding your cat raw spinach can be risky. It has some vitamins like A and B6, but it can also cause problems. Raw spinach contains calcium oxalate. This can lead to kidney stones in cats. Symptoms may include vomiting and diarrhea.

    Cooking spinach can help. It lowers oxalate levels and makes it easier to digest. Always serve it plain and in small amounts. Watch your cat closely after feeding spinach. Look for any signs of an upset stomach.

  • Can Cat Eat Raw Oysters

    Feeding your cat raw oysters can be dangerous. These oysters may have harmful bacteria like Vibrio vulnificus and Norovirus. These bacteria can cause severe vomiting and diarrhea in cats. Raw oysters also contain thiaminase. This can lead to thiamine deficiency, which may harm your cat’s brain health.

    Cooked oysters are a safer option. Cook them to at least 145°F (63°C). Serve them plain, without any seasonings. Always check with your vet before trying new foods for your cat.
